Output 9501ddbc1aabc83c71e3b61291ab35d629214d6f6d9ef4f3f2e9989791f22a8a:4

value
17090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c9e63fb8483254685e8d26f14ca477a2379894 OP_EQUAL
address
3H5VJzGWuGtXvos3yk8GnMU9XVJFvoNWCj
transaction
9501ddbc1aabc83c71e3b61291ab35d629214d6f6d9ef4f3f2e9989791f22a8a
confirmations
472949
spent
true